Configuration Management is typically a practice which is highly ignored in many IT Departments. This is more so when IT is not the main purpose of the Business of the Organisation. It is often felt that investing in Configuration Management does not make enough Business Sense. However, when evaluated carefully, a good Configuration Management Department can offer the following benefits.
- Helps in increasing the VELOCITY OF THE IT DEPARTMENT. This directly help in reducing TIME TO MARKET for the Business.
- Helps in higher reliability of the products deployed in the Production System. This helps in better quality of the IT products which increases the Customer Satisfaction Index.
- Helps cut downtime due to misbehaviour of a product in Production System by helping in restoring a good version of the software till the error has been fixed and tested. This can help reduce Product Failure Rate in the Market and thus increasing Revenue Potential besides increasing Customer Satisfaction.
- Helps optimise the internal working of the IT Department and this the IT Management can make best use of the available resources.
- By default, Configuration Management Department provides for security from loss of essential solution part and/or the IT Department from being held at ransom by its experts.
There are many more benefits.
